About Southwest Airlines Co

Southwest Airlines is the largest domestic carrier in the United States, as measured by the number of originating passengers boarded. Southwest operates over 700 aircraft in an all-Boeing 737 fleet. Despite expanding into longer routes and business travel, the airline still specializes in short-haul leisure flights, using a point-to-point network. Southwest operates a low-cost carrier business model.

About Prudential PLC

Prudential is an Asia and Africa health and life insurance business and is focused on long-term savings. The business is increasingly focusing on digital offerings and creating strong brand equity and relationships with customers of its products through these.
